The Red Mill building might look a little familiar. Built around 1810, it’s an iconic NJ image that now houses a majority of the museum’s exhibits exploring the art and history of the Clinton area. Other buildings on the property include a historic schoolhouse, log cabin, and the Mulligan Quarry.
